World Fiddle Day - TODAY!

Today is the first World Fiddle Day - that is (among many other things), a day dedicated to the instrument that the Father of Bluegrass considered central to his music.

The editor will employ some of the methods recommended on the World Fiddle Day website to celebrate the occasion - viz. getting out a neglected fiddle and playing it, and also listening to some of the great players of the past, such as the magnificent Ed Haley and Paul Warren. Thanks to Caoimhin Mac Aoidh of Donegal for bringing this concept to fruition.
